Siem Reap Strengthens Investment Planning for 2027 to 2029: What Should You Know?

Siem Reap is taking another important step toward strengthening its long term development by improving the way investment projects are planned and managed for the 2027 to 2029 period.

On Tuesday, the Siem Reap Provincial Administration, together with the Provincial Department of Planning, organised a capacity building training programme for technical officials to sharpen their planning and data analysis skills. The initiative is designed to ensure future investment decisions are based on reliable evidence, respond to the real needs of local communities, and remain aligned with the government’s Phase I Pentagonal Strategy.

Investment planning for Siem Reap 2027–2029

The training reflects the province’s broader commitment to sustainable economic growth, stronger public investment, and better coordination across government agencies. By improving planning methods and addressing existing weaknesses, provincial leaders hope to create more effective development programmes that support tourism, agriculture, infrastructure, and local livelihoods while preparing Siem Reap for future economic opportunities.

Why Better Planning Matters for Future Development?

The training programme was chaired by Siem Reap Deputy Governor Sok Thul, who highlighted the importance of accurate situation analysis as the foundation of successful development planning. He explained that investment decisions must be supported by reliable data and thorough analysis to ensure projects genuinely meet the needs of residents rather than relying on assumptions.

According to Thul, careful analysis also allows authorities to allocate public budgets, human resources, and development funding more efficiently. When investment priorities are based on evidence, government projects are more likely to deliver meaningful and lasting benefits for communities throughout the province.

Officials Identify Challenges in Investment Planning

The workshop also provided an opportunity for technical officials to review obstacles that have affected previous investment planning efforts. Participants discussed several recurring issues, including limited coordination between technical departments, frequent staff changes, insufficient planning experience, and inconsistencies in project preparation across communes and districts.

Recognising these challenges is an important step toward improving future planning. Provincial authorities believe that stronger collaboration and more consistent technical standards will help ensure investment projects are implemented more effectively and produce better development outcomes across Siem Reap.

Building Technical Skills for Better Investment Decisions

To strengthen planning capacity, the provincial administration introduced additional technical training focused on SWOT analysis, monitoring and evaluation, and integrated development planning. These skills are intended to improve coordination between infrastructure development and broader economic and social programmes.

The expanded training is expected to help officials transform development priorities into practical investment proposals supported by evidence and measurable objectives. Better planning will also improve cooperation among government departments responsible for implementing projects throughout the province.

Supporting Tourism, Agriculture, and Local Businesses

Alongside improving investment planning, provincial authorities are continuing efforts to strengthen the local economy by encouraging small and medium sized enterprises to complete formal business registration. The initiative supports broader efforts to expand economic opportunities while improving governance across the private sector.

“Despite challenges from global economic conditions and recent tourism disruptions, Siem Reap authorities continue implementing government strategies to revive tourism and improve agricultural and aquaculture productivity to support poverty reduction,” he said.

These efforts demonstrate the province’s determination to diversify economic growth while reinforcing two of its most important industries. Tourism remains a major driver of the local economy, while stronger agricultural and aquaculture production helps improve rural incomes and reduce poverty.

Positive Economic Performance Strengthens Confidence

Thul noted that preliminary situation analysis prepared by the Ministry of Planning shows encouraging economic performance for Siem Reap during 2025. According to the assessment, the province recorded total trade exceeding $2.1 billion, while average annual income per person increased to $2,191.

These indicators provide a stronger foundation for future investment planning and suggest that continued improvements in governance, infrastructure, and economic management could further strengthen the province’s long term development.
